Writeup from MB 111:

Northwest Africa 15122 (NWA 15122)

(Northwest Africa)

Purchased: 2020 Jun

Classification: Ordinary chondrite (H4)

History: Purchased by John Divelbiss in June 2020 from a dealer in Tombstone, Arizona, who had obtained the material from a Moroccan source.

Petrography: (A. Irving, UWS and J. Boesenberg, BrownU) Relatively small, well-formed equilibrated chondrules containing devitrified glass and plagioclase are set in a relatively coarse grained matrix containing altered kamacite, chromite, troilite, merrillite and Fe phosphate, but no plagioclase.

Geochemistry: Olivine (Fa19.0±0.4, range Fa18.7-19.2, N = 7), low-Ca pyroxene (Fs17.0±0.3Wo1.3±0.3, range Fs16.5-17.2Wo1.0-1.7, N = 7).

Classification: Ordinary chondrite (H4).

Specimens: 22.5 g including one polished thin section at UWB; remainder with Mr. J. Divelbiss.
